Gesture & Motion Installations in India

We design the interaction model around your message, then build the sensing setup using depth cameras or motion sensors paired with real-time visual software. Guests trigger animations, particle effects or data responses with their movement, which works well for crowded environments where touch-free is preferable. We manage hardware, calibration for the venue lighting, and on-site tuning so the installation reads movement accurately. These installations create spectacle and dwell while keeping participation effortless and inclusive for large foot-traffic spaces.

What is gesture & motion installations?

Gesture and motion installations use cameras and sensors to track how guests move, then respond with reactive visuals, sound or lighting. Fiona Premium Events designs and builds these touch-free experiences so audiences interact with a brand simply by waving, walking or gesturing, creating memorable hands-free moments at events and exhibitions.

01Does the installation work in bright venue lighting?

Sensing accuracy depends on lighting, so we calibrate the hardware to your venue conditions and recommend a setup that performs reliably. During the site survey we flag any lighting changes needed to keep tracking responsive.

02How many people can interact at the same time?

It depends on the sensing setup and the experience design. Some installations respond to a single lead participant while others react to a whole crowd. We design the interaction model to suit your expected footfall.

03Is the experience accessible to all guests?

Because participation is touch-free and movement-based, gesture installations are easy and inclusive to use. We design interactions that respond to natural movement so guests of varying ages and abilities can take part comfortably.
